aboutsumma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orEuAndreh <eu@euandre.org>2022-02-19 19:50:08 -0300
committerEuAndreh <eu@euandre.org>2022-02-19 19:50:08 -0300
commit0ec4294d3b0e28a42b92399b1ac3b480e1fcabcd (patch)
treea2987b3e0c1bad48b5eecad26b225140a5747208
parentaux/: Update (diff)
downloadtd-0ec4294d3b0e28a42b92399b1ac3b480e1fcabcd.tar.gz
td-0ec4294d3b0e28a42b92399b1ac3b480e1fcabcd.tar.xz
Makefile: Include append $(NAME) to the definition of $(LIBEXECDIR)
-rw-r--r--Makefile10
-rwxr-xr-xsrc/td.in4
2 files changed, 7 insertions, 7 deletions
diff --git a/Makefile b/Makefile
index c33c1fa..8d57c45 100644
--- a/Makefile
+++ b/Makefile
@@ -7,7 +7,7 @@ TRANSLATIONS = pt fr eo es
CONTRIBLANGS =
PREFIX = /usr/local
BINDIR = $(PREFIX)/bin
-LIBEXECDIR = $(PREFIX)/libexec
+LIBEXECDIR = $(PREFIX)/libexec/$(NAME)
SHAREDIR = $(PREFIX)/share
LOCALEDIR = $(SHAREDIR)/locale
MANDIR = $(SHAREDIR)/man
@@ -89,11 +89,11 @@ clean:
install: all
mkdir -p \
- $(DESTDIR)$(BINDIR) \
- $(DESTDIR)$(LIBEXECDIR)/$(NAME) \
+ $(DESTDIR)$(BINDIR) \
+ $(DESTDIR)$(LIBEXECDIR) \
$(DESTDIR)$(LOCALEDIR)
cp src/$(NAME) $(DESTDIR)$(BINDIR)
- cp src/locale/load-messages.sh $(DESTDIR)$(LIBEXECDIR)/$(NAME)
+ cp src/locale/load-messages.sh $(DESTDIR)$(LIBEXECDIR)
for l in $(TRANSLATIONS) en $(CONTRIBLANGS); do \
mkdir -p $(DESTDIR)$(LOCALEDIR)/$$l/LC_MESSAGES/$(NAME); \
cp \
@@ -105,7 +105,7 @@ install: all
uninstall:
rm -f \
$(DESTDIR)$(BINDIR)/$(NAME) \
- $(DESTDIR)$(LIBEXECDIR)/$(NAME)/load-messages.sh
+ $(DESTDIR)$(LIBEXECDIR)/load-messages.sh
for l in $(TRANSLATIONS) en $(CONTRIBLANGS); do \
rm -f $(DESTDIR)$(LOCALEDIR)/$$l/LC_MESSAGES/$(NAME)/*; \
done
diff --git a/src/td.in b/src/td.in
index db74a82..c6a7e9f 100755
--- a/src/td.in
+++ b/src/td.in
@@ -128,8 +128,8 @@ if [ -n "${TD_DUMP_TRANSLATABLE_STRINGS:-}" ]; then
exit
fi
-if [ -r '@LIBEXECDIR@/@NAME@/load-messages.sh' ]; then
- . '@LIBEXECDIR@/@NAME@/load-messages.sh'
+if [ -r '@LIBEXECDIR@/load-messages.sh' ]; then
+ . '@LIBEXECDIR@/load-messages.sh'
fi